phone booth

英 [ˈfəʊn buːð]

美 [ˈfoʊn buːθ]

n.  (半封闭的)公用电话间,电话亭

牛津词典

    noun

    • (半封闭的)公用电话间,电话亭
      a place that is partly separated from the surrounding area, containing a public telephone, in a hotel, restaurant, in the street, etc.

      柯林斯词典

      • 公共电话亭
        Aphone boothis a place in a station, hotel, or other public building where there is a public telephone.
        1. 同phone box
          Aphone boothis the same as aphone box.
